About the Event
Come get your feet wet at The Nature Conservancy Lubberland Creek Preserve! We'll be using various techniques to identify, count and monitor the fish species in both the tidal and fresh water section of the Lubberland creek prior to our restoration activities. No experience necessary.
What to bring
Volunteers should bring a hat, water, rubber boots, and clothes you don't mind getting wet. Tall rubber boots are recommended, and if you have waders you can try your hand at some in stream netting.
